1,006,902 (one million six thousand nine hundred two) is an even 7-digit number. It is a composite number with 36 divisors, and factors as 2 × 3² × 13² × 331. Its proper divisors sum to 1,362,582, more than the number itself, making it an abundant number.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0xF5D36.
